Blockage of tubular epithelial to myofibroblast transition by hepatocyte growth factor prevents renal interstitial fibrosis

J Yang, Y Liu - Journal of the American Society of Nephrology, 2002 - journals.lww.com
Activation of α-smooth muscle actin–positive myofibroblast cells is a key event in the
progression of chronic renal diseases that leads to end-stage renal failure. Although the
origin of these myofibroblasts in the kidney remains uncertain, emerging evidence suggests
that renal myofibroblasts may derive from tubular epithelial cells by a process of epithelial to
mesenchymal transition. It was demonstrated that hepatocyte growth factor (HGF) exhibited
